Trying to submit registration but I can't finish because the site will not accept the date for my child's age. He is already 5 years old, but the calendar is not recognizing 2015 as a year that makes the child 5 years old already. I just keep getting an error that says the child must be 5 by September 1.

It looks like the age calculator is not accounting for exact birthdays correctly. Simply checking the year can cause problems like this. The system should check year, month, and day so it only accepts a child as 5 years old if their birthday has already passed by September 1.
For example, a child born in 2015 might not yet be 5 by September 1, depending on the exact birthdate. The calculator needs to consider the full date, not just the year.
